LEATHERHEAD centre-back Chris Boulter has signed a two-year contract with the club.

The defender has committed his immediate future to the Fetcham Grove club by signing a one-year deal, with an option for second.

That means that should anyone be interested in the Tanners vice-captain, they will have to make an offer for him.

Boulter may not be the only player to be put on a permanent contract as the club aims to move up to the Ryman Premier Division.

Football secretary Geoff Corner said: "We want to get into the Premier Division and to do that we have to keep hold of our best players. We are highly delighted to have got Chris on a contract and there are plans if Mick [Sullivan] wants anyone else on contract we will."

Manager Mick Sullivan said: "We wanted to get Chris on contract and he was pleased to commit to another year minimum and he feels the club's going in the right direction. Everyone's pretty positive about staying around for the next year and the vibes are very good."
